Meticulously maintained for over 20 years, this turn-key 2 bedroom home sits in the heart of Lake Cowichan. This home can sleep up to 9 people with pull-out couches (fully furnished option available) and features 2 full bathrooms. Inside, you’ll find a thoughtfully detailed interior that reflects pride of ownership throughout. Step outside to an immaculate, private yard—perfect for relaxing or entertaining. The property also includes RV parking with water and sewer hookups, adding flexibility for visitors or additional use. Enjoy year-round comfort with a brand-new heat pump and air conditioning, keeping you cool during those warm summer days. Located across from the Trans Canada Trail and close to Saywell Park where you will find a great dock for swimming and enjoying the river. Walking distance to everything the town of Lake Cowichan has to offer—shops, dining, recreation, and more. A rare opportunity to own a well-cared-for, move-in-ready home in an unbeatable location.
